Transaction 0489f6224735a58603ed31a170ff247dd5480388a2991af689938c0d74a7b924
1 Input
1 Output
-
0489f6224735a58603ed31a170ff247dd5480388a2991af689938c0d74a7b924:0
- value
- 680603
- script pubkey
- OP_0 OP_PUSHBYTES_32 fbca2e6bc99366d2fc039f6563d00d96b67b990f4ec3c3105dbb33188ad4bafa
- address
- bc1ql09zu67fjdnd9lqrnajk85qdj6m8hxg0fmpuxyzahve33zk5htaqny5kyn